How they compare

Mauritius currently reports 1,428 m3 against 1,086 m3 in Samoa, a difference of 342 m3.

That makes Mauritius's figure about 1.3 times Samoa's.

Across all 14 years both countries report, Mauritius has been ahead every year.

Mauritius ranks 75th and Samoa ranks 78th of 153 countries.

Mauritius has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
